What you will be responsible for

As Transfer Agency Investor and Distributor Services, Senior Associate you will

LEADERSHIP

  • Actively participate in the performance appraisal process with Associates

  • Monitor individual and team performance and with the support of your Officer provide regular feedback throughout the year to Associates

  • Actively contribute to department staff planning, including recruitment and succession planning and remaining within budgeted staff numbers

  • Promote a positive working environment and good levels of team morale

CLIENT RELATIONSHIP

  • Develop and maintain strong client relationships

  • Handle and resolve complex/unusual client queries

  • Ensure that procedures, policies and processes are adhered to so that a high quality service is delivered to the customer. 

  • Propose and/or implement procedural changes to improve processes

COMMUNICATION

  • Attend and contribute to operational, client, risk, audit and regulatory meetings as required

  • Communicate relevant information as appropriate up and down the line and escalate where necessary

  • Attend and actively participate in all team meetings, ensuring communication is open

RISK & REGULATORY

  • Ensure compliance as appropriate with regulatory requirements and with the relevant short, medium and long-term goals, objectives and values of the organization

  • Understand the risk environment within the team & manage appropriately

  • Ensure avoidance of IDD’s is discussed with the team on a regular basis.

  • Monitor the development and implementation of appropriate procedures to meet internal control  and external compliance/regulatory requirements

TEAM MANAGEMENT

  • Manage resources to ensure all queries and tasks are resolved in a timely manner

  • Work as an effective team member with other internal providers to meet our key deliverables

  • Act as a point of escalation for team members/internal providers with challenges or concerns relating to the IDS team and manage these issues to resolution, with consideration for the internal escalation policy

  • Assist in the resource management of the team, including the planning and management of holiday leave, training days and sick leave

  • Ensure the team procedures are operationally sound with an emphasis on risk reduction and compliance issues, that they are in place for all tasks and that they are adhered to

  • Foster an environment where team members are developed, trained, coached and mentored to bring them to a high standard of knowledge and quality, making use of the Training Pathways provided. 

  • Focus on development opportunities for your Associate 2’s with Staff and ensure that time is made available to focus on non-operational management aspects of role through the delegation of tasks where appropriate.

  • Work with your Officer to develop and assign team goals and objectives which are in line with overall organizational goals

  • Support and champion team integration within the department along with interdepartmental and organizational integration

TECHNICAL KNOWLEDGE / PROCESS IMPROVEMENT

  • Ensure that specialist knowledge relating to the team is kept current and disseminated as appropriate and be aware of possible future developments and trends

  • Proactively identify and act on opportunities to improve current processes to meet the changing requirements of our clients, to improve efficiency, or to reduce risk

  • Ensure an awareness of and adherence to the key TA controls at all times

  • Ensure team participation in the completion and implementation of department wide projects as required and to lead local team initiatives

  • Participate in data review, including checking and sign-off of work, where controls require Senior Associate sign-off
